POWER ARCHITECTS PA20004UP

Description
Power Architects PA20004UP Power Supply - PA2000, 4U up enclosure with 5VDC-80A, +12VDC-8A, +12VDC-10A and 12VDC-10A industrial power supply.

Specifications
Conducted EMI
EN 55022 Class A Compliant
Cooling
Internal Built-in Fans, 40 CFM Total
Current Share
Available on Single Output Modules (1-terminal or 2-terminal differential bus)
DC Power Good Signal
-10% at Any Output; Optional
Dimensions
2-module 480W: 2.50" x 4.13" x 7.30"; 3-module 700W: 2.50" x 5.00" x 7.30"; 4-module 1000W: 2.50" x 5.88" x 7.30"; 5-module 1200W: 2.50" x 6.75" x 7.30"
Efficiency
75% min.; 115 VAC
Global Output Inhibit
Isolated TTL input
Hold-Up Time
> 20 mSec.; 90 VAC
Humidity
5 to 95% non-condensing
Input Operating Voltage
90-264 VAC (47-63 Hz)
Inrush Current
45A max.; 240 VAC
Operating Temperature
-40 to 75 deg. C
Output Over Current Protection
105-125% of Full Load (Automatic Recovery)
Output Over Temperature Protection
55 deg. C Ambient (Latching); 700 W (output)
Output Over Voltage Protection
115-125% of Nominal Output Voltage (Latching)
Output Ripple and Noise
0.5% or 20 mV pk-pk (whichever is greater)(0.25% or 10mV pk-pk typical) w/ 20 MHz BW, any load
Power Factor Correction
>0.99 Meets EN 61000-3-2 Class D
Power Fail Warning
> 8 mSec.; 90 VAC
Regulation
Line 0% w/ 90 to 264 VAC, Load 0.2% max. w/ No Load to Full Load, Cross 0% in Any Condition, Thermal 0.02%/deg. C max. w/0 to 75 deg. C
Remote Sense
0.5V max. Cable Drop Compensation
Safety
UL, cUL, TÜV
Storage Temperature
-20 to 85 deg. C
Total Output Power
1200 W, 180-264 VAC w/ -40 to 50 deg. C; 700 W, 90-180 VAC w/ -40 to 50 deg. C; derate linearly to 500W at 75 deg. C
Transient Response
3% or 150 mV (whichever is greater); 250 uSec Recovery to 1% or 50 mV w/ 25% Step Load from 75% to 100% or from 100% to 75%
Undervoltage Lockout
80 VAC typ.
VME/VXI Signals
Per VME/VXI Specification; Optional
